Rehearsals are well underway for Halifax composer Togni’s new opera.

Nova Scotia composer Peter-Anthony Togni has just completed his first opera, with libretto by Sharon Singer.  The new work, which has been underway since 2010, is now in rehearsal in Toronto, and Classic Concerts NS has a sneak peek rehearsal photo of  the Love Scene with singers Lucia Cesaroni (Isis) and Newfoundland’s Michael Barrett (Osiris).

Other  singers are Michael Nyby as Seth and CBC Radio Two’s Julie Nesrallah as Nepthys.

Not up on your Egyptian Gods?  Here’s a brief synopsis, provided by librettist Sharon Singer:

Isis and Osiris, Gods of Egypt is inspired by a strange and compelling ancient Egyptian myth that centers of one of the world’s great love stories. Four siblings, children of the gods, Isis, Osiris, Seth, and Nepthys  come to earth to live as human beings. The idealistic King Osiris and his sister-wife Queen Isis bring their people the gifts of civilization: agriculture, weaving, a code of laws, the arts, and worship of the gods. Their brother Seth, however, is jealous of their power, their wisdom, and their devotion to each other. He murders  Osiris and usurps the throne, provoking a conflagration that Isis with all her strength, love, and magic, must try to extinguish.
